Green Day surprised fans at the Festival d’été de Québec Sunday night, June 16, when they debuted a catchy new song, “1981.”
The upbeat no-nonsense pop punk whose chorus seems to say, “she’s gonna bang her head like 1981” was introduced after the trio played “Minority” (which is 23 years old now).
Near the end of the two minute tune, a now-bleach blonde Billie Joe, wearing a black shirt and red tie, yelled “let’s go crazy,” and after the song ended the band broke into an Operation Ivy cover.
“1981” would join an interesting collection of Green Day songs that include numbers.
In order of most-played by the Berkeley rockers there is “2000 Light Years Away” from Kerplunk!, “21 Guns” from 21st Century Breakdown, “21st Century Breakdown” from that LP, “16” from Dookie, “99 Revolutions,” from ¡Tré!, “409 in Your Coffeemaker,” off the Slappy EP, “86” from Insomniac, the title track of the 1000 Hours EP, and “80” from Kerplunk!
